Meeting and Pickup

When joining the Magnetic Island Sailing Cruise, participants can expect a seamless meeting and pickup process to ensure a hassle-free start to their adventure.

The meeting point for the cruise is the Peppers Blue on Blue Resort Magnetic Island, located at 123 Sooning St, Nelly Bay QLD 4819, Australia.

To reach the meeting point, participants can take the Sealink Ferry to Magnetic Island and then turn left after disembarking, following the foreshore to the Peppers Blue on Blue deck.

The skipper will be waiting on the deck at 8:15 am to greet the participants. It’s recommended to arrive on time to avoid any delays.

As for attire, participants should wear comfortable clothing and bring sunscreen, a hat, and sunglasses for sun protection.

Plus, participants are encouraged to bring their own snorkeling equipment, although it’s provided on the cruise.

Cancellation Policy

Magnetic Island Sailing Cruise Ex Townsville - Cancellation Policy

Participants of the Magnetic Island Sailing Cruise should be aware of the cancellation policy in order to ensure a seamless and stress-free experience. Here are the key details regarding the refund policy and rescheduling options:

  • Full refund if canceled at least 24 hours in advance.
  • No refund if canceled less than 24 hours before the start time.
  • No changes accepted less than 24 hours before the start time.
  • Cut-off times are based on the local time.
  • Full refund or rescheduling offered if the experience is canceled due to poor weather or not meeting the minimum number of travelers.

Directions

Magnetic Island Sailing Cruise Ex Townsville - Directions

To find your way to the meeting point for the Magnetic Island Sailing Cruise, head to Peppers Blue on Blue Resort Magnetic Island located at 123 Sooning St, Nelly Bay QLD 4819, Australia. After disembarking the Sealink Ferry on Magnetic Island, turn left and follow the foreshore to the Peppers Blue on Blue deck.

The skipper will meet you on the deck at 8.15 am.

If you’re looking for alternative routes to get to the meeting point, there are a few transportation options available. You can take a taxi from Townsville to the ferry terminal, where you can catch the Sealink Ferry to Magnetic Island.

Another option is to drive to the ferry terminal and park your car there before boarding the ferry.
